Textpattern - на русском языке

форум общения русскоязычных пользователей CMS Текстпаттерн

Вы не зашли.

#1 17-08-2008 16:29:54

80689248440
земля
Откуда: Симферополь
Зарегистрирован: 07-08-2008
Сообщений: 112
Вебсайт

sitemap

Как сделать карту сайта в формате xml?
Чтоб постоянно обновлялась


Хочешь заработать - спроси меня как!

Неактивен

 

#2 17-08-2008 19:36:52

the_ghost
ять
Откуда: Минск
Зарегистрирован: 01-05-2007
Сообщений: 1957
Вебсайт

Re: sitemap

Плагин jmd_sitemap


.      Создание шаблонов для Textpatern http://textpattern.ru/forum/viewtopic.php?id=1665 (<txp:make_template quality="best" />)
КОНСУЛЬТАЦИИ по Textpattern - ICQ#8458496, nemiga@gmail.com <txp:if_question><txp:pay /></txp:if_question>
       Список всех тегов - http://textbook.textpattern.net/wiki/in … _Reference

Неактивен

 

#3 14-01-2010 10:01:02

froZZen
он
Откуда: vrn - spb
Зарегистрирован: 05-10-2005
Сообщений: 273
Вебсайт

Re: sitemap

Использую этот плагин, но возник вопрос:
в Гугле все прекрасно, а Яндекс сказал, что мой файл "сплошная ошибка" - Некорректный URL (не соответствует местоположению файла Sitemap).
Из их объяснения ошибки:
"Местоположение файла Sitemap определяет набор URL, которые можно включить в этот Sitemap. Файл Sitemap, расположенный в некотором каталоге должен включать URL, расположенные в этом же каталоге, либо его подкаталогах. Подробнее см. Местоположение файла Sitemap"

Файл sitemap.xml.gz расположен в корне сайта - www.имя_сайта/sitemap.xml.gz. Ругается на все ссылки.

Кто может объяснить мне непонятливому что не так и как с этим побороться? smile

Неактивен

 

#4 14-01-2010 13:43:58

itshaman
слово
Откуда: Омск
Зарегистрирован: 03-06-2009
Сообщений: 395
Вебсайт

Re: sitemap

Мне больше нравится rah_sitemap


Помогу сделать Ваш сайт лучше! Принимаю Webmoney, PayPal, рубли, доллары, печеньки

Неактивен

 

#5 14-01-2010 14:19:04

froZZen
он
Откуда: vrn - spb
Зарегистрирован: 05-10-2005
Сообщений: 273
Вебсайт

Re: sitemap

itshaman написал:

Мне больше нравится rah_sitemap

Да дело-то, наверное, не в плагине, а в содержании sitemap. Какая-то проблема у Яндекса именно из-за ссылок, которые в файле. Какая?!

Неактивен

 

#6 14-01-2010 15:42:07

itshaman
слово
Откуда: Омск
Зарегистрирован: 03-06-2009
Сообщений: 395
Вебсайт

Re: sitemap

С плагином, который я привел, ПС Я работает отлично.
Проблема есть в том, что этот плагин почему-то считает меньше страниц, чем сторонние WEB-сервисы


Помогу сделать Ваш сайт лучше! Принимаю Webmoney, PayPal, рубли, доллары, печеньки

Неактивен

 

#7 14-01-2010 17:32:15

froZZen
он
Откуда: vrn - spb
Зарегистрирован: 05-10-2005
Сообщений: 273
Вебсайт

Re: sitemap

itshaman написал:

С плагином, который я привел, ПС Я работает отлично.
Проблема есть в том, что этот плагин почему-то считает меньше страниц, чем сторонние WEB-сервисы

Приведите, плиз, кусочек формируемого файла.

Вот мой кусок:

Код:

<?xml version="1.0" encoding="utf-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
  <url>
    <loc>http://www.frozzen.name/</loc>
  </url>
  <url>
    <loc>http://www.frozzen.name/index.php?s=about</loc>
  </url>
...
  <url>
    <loc>http://www.frozzen.name/index.php?s=gallery</loc>
  </url>
  <url>
    <loc>http://www.frozzen.name/index.php?id=1</loc>
    <lastmod>2005-11-08T13:26:39+03:00</lastmod>
  </url>
  <url>
    <loc>http://www.frozzen.name/index.php?id=3</loc>
    <lastmod>2006-01-30T19:36:25+03:00</lastmod>
  </url>
....
</urlset>

Яндекс поругался на первые 100 ссылок и прекратил обработку ввиду огромного кол-ва ошибок.
Думаю, что плагин тут ни при чем. Хотя судя по описанию он гораздо интереснее jmd_sitemap - так что все равно на него перейду когда время будет.

Но сейчас меня все же интересует вопрос с Яндексом

Неактивен

 

#8 19-01-2010 14:50:30

froZZen
он
Откуда: vrn - spb
Зарегистрирован: 05-10-2005
Сообщений: 273
Вебсайт

Re: sitemap

Попробовал rah_sitemap.
Файл слово в слово такой же. Сомневаюсь, что Яндекс его примет.

В чем же беда?!

зы. Почему-то мне эта история с Яндексом напомнила об одной истории из моей основной работы: Для отчетности мы формируем XML-файлы установленного стандарта. В целях "не забивать себе голову" наш файл формируется без всякого форматирования - одной строкой. Недавно появилась еще одна смежная организация, которой мы тоже шлем этот файл. Звонит оттуда тетечка и говорит: "А не могли бы вы так формировать свой файл, чтобы его удобно было в Блокноте открывать и смотреть!!! И кроме того наши программисты написали прогу, которая открывает такие файлы и запихивает данные из них в Эксель. Так вот ваш XML-файл эта прога разобрать не может, потому что нету переносов!!!".
Сдается мне, что и Яндекс XML читает как-то не так как Гугл.

Отредактированно froZZen (19-01-2010 15:00:20)

Неактивен

 

#9 19-01-2010 17:26:44

makss
наш
Зарегистрирован: 21-10-2008
Сообщений: 208
Вебсайт

Re: sitemap

froZZen написал:

зы. Почему-то мне эта история с Яндексом напомнила об одной истории из моей основной работы:
[ skip ]
Сдается мне, что и Яндекс XML читает как-то не так как Гугл.

Скорее всего так и есть...  ну почти как переводы строк.

Сейчас у вас в ситемапе отдается в хеадере:

Код:

Content-Type: application/x-gzip
Content-Encoding: x-gzip

Попробуйте отдавать:

Код:

Content-Type: application/xml
Content-Encoding: gzip

Плагин rah_sitemap именно такой хеадер и отдает. Яндекс все кушает без ошибок.


aks_rss : RSS parser and aggregator | http://makss.uaho.net/plugins/aks_rss
aks_table : Simple tables in TxP (Ctrl+C, Ctrl+V) | http://makss.uaho.net/plugins/aks_table

Неактивен

 

#10 19-01-2010 18:30:03

froZZen
он
Откуда: vrn - spb
Зарегистрирован: 05-10-2005
Сообщений: 273
Вебсайт

Re: sitemap

makss написал:

Сейчас у вас в ситемапе отдается в хеадере:

Код:

Content-Type: application/x-gzip
Content-Encoding: x-gzip

Попробуйте отдавать:

Код:

Content-Type: application/xml
Content-Encoding: gzip

Плагин rah_sitemap именно такой хеадер и отдает. Яндекс все кушает без ошибок.

А где это настраивается?
И нормально ли это будет кушаться Гуглом?

Неактивен

 

#11 19-01-2010 19:50:40

makss
наш
Зарегистрирован: 21-10-2008
Сообщений: 208
Вебсайт

Re: sitemap

Хеадер задается внутри плагина, так что или править код или просто замените один плагин на другой.

Потом можете в панеле вебмастера(у яндекса и гугля) скормить по-новой sitemap яндексу и гуглю - сразу будут видны ошибки, если они есть.

ps: Если нужен rah_sitemap для 4-го php, то пропатченная версия лежит у меня на сайте.


aks_rss : RSS parser and aggregator | http://makss.uaho.net/plugins/aks_rss
aks_table : Simple tables in TxP (Ctrl+C, Ctrl+V) | http://makss.uaho.net/plugins/aks_table

Неактивен

 

#12 23-01-2010 10:49:07

froZZen
он
Откуда: vrn - spb
Зарегистрирован: 05-10-2005
Сообщений: 273
Вебсайт

Re: sitemap

Установил и опробовал rah_sitemap.

Гугл еще не проверял (но мне почему-то кажется что у него вопросов не возникнет).
А Яндекс вновь выдал ту же самую ошибку:

Некорректный URL (не соответствует местоположению файла Sitemap)
И так для каждой ссылки.
После 100 ошибки - Слишком много ошибок (обработка прекращена)

Описание ошибки:
Местоположение файла Sitemap определяет набор URL, которые можно включить в этот Sitemap. Файл Sitemap, расположенный в некотором каталоге должен включать URL, расположенные в этом же каталоге, либо его подкаталогах.

Что-то намудрили, а ЧТО не понятно... sad
Может все-таки кто-то знает что ЭТО за беда такая?!

Неактивен

 

#13 23-01-2010 12:00:49

itshaman
слово
Откуда: Омск
Зарегистрирован: 03-06-2009
Сообщений: 395
Вебсайт

Re: sitemap

froZZen написал:

Установил и опробовал rah_sitemap.

Гугл еще не проверял (но мне почему-то кажется что у него вопросов не возникнет).
А Яндекс вновь выдал ту же самую ошибку:

Некорректный URL (не соответствует местоположению файла Sitemap)
И так для каждой ссылки.

Какой адрес Вы отдаете Yandex`у?


Помогу сделать Ваш сайт лучше! Принимаю Webmoney, PayPal, рубли, доллары, печеньки

Неактивен

 

#14 23-01-2010 12:09:44

froZZen
он
Откуда: vrn - spb
Зарегистрирован: 05-10-2005
Сообщений: 273
Вебсайт

Re: sitemap

itshaman написал:

Какой адрес Вы отдаете Yandex`у?

http://www.frozzen.name/sitemap.xml.gz

Неактивен

 

#15 23-01-2010 12:46:23

sbel
веди
Зарегистрирован: 23-01-2010
Сообщений: 15

Re: sitemap

froZZen написал:

itshaman написал:

Какой адрес Вы отдаете Yandex`у?

http://www.frozzen.name/sitemap.xml.gz

Глупый вопрос, а сайт в яндекс-вебмастер тоже зарегистрирован с www ?
т.е. он должен быть www.frozzen.name



зы: не по теме - попутно желательно добавить в robots.txt строку
Host: www.frozzen.name

Неактивен

 

#16 23-01-2010 13:16:37

the_ghost
ять
Откуда: Минск
Зарегистрирован: 01-05-2007
Сообщений: 1957
Вебсайт

Re: sitemap

Надо попробовать без .gz отдать урл. Вроде как в текущем варианте ожидается архивированный вариант карты


.      Создание шаблонов для Textpatern http://textpattern.ru/forum/viewtopic.php?id=1665 (<txp:make_template quality="best" />)
КОНСУЛЬТАЦИИ по Textpattern - ICQ#8458496, nemiga@gmail.com <txp:if_question><txp:pay /></txp:if_question>
       Список всех тегов - http://textbook.textpattern.net/wiki/in … _Reference

Неактивен

 

#17 23-01-2010 13:59:52

froZZen
он
Откуда: vrn - spb
Зарегистрирован: 05-10-2005
Сообщений: 273
Вебсайт

Re: sitemap

sbel написал:

froZZen написал:

itshaman написал:

Какой адрес Вы отдаете Yandex`у?

http://www.frozzen.name/sitemap.xml.gz

Глупый вопрос, а сайт в яндекс-вебмастер тоже зарегистрирован с www ?
т.е. он должен быть www.frozzen.name

зы: не по теме - попутно желательно добавить в robots.txt строку
Host: www.frozzen.name

В Яндексе действительно без www.

А если в роботе.тхт уже прописано Sitemap: http://www.frozzen.name/sitemap.xml.gz (писалось намного раньше - для Гугла), что тогда лучше сделать?
Удалить текущий сайт и добавить с www?

Неактивен

 

#18 23-01-2010 14:57:43

sbel
веди
Зарегистрирован: 23-01-2010
Сообщений: 15

Re: sitemap

froZZen написал:

В Яндексе действительно без www.

А если в роботе.тхт уже прописано Sitemap: http://www.frozzen.name/sitemap.xml.gz (писалось намного раньше - для Гугла), что тогда лучше сделать?
Удалить текущий сайт и добавить с www?

просто удалить и по новой добавить с www

Отредактированно sbel (23-01-2010 16:30:36)

Неактивен

 

#19 24-01-2010 20:29:35

froZZen
он
Откуда: vrn - spb
Зарегистрирован: 05-10-2005
Сообщений: 273
Вебсайт

Re: sitemap

sbel написал:

просто удалить и по новой добавить с www

ОК. Теперь все нормально. Всем Спасибо! smile

Неактивен

 

Board footer

RSS   Rambler's Top100
Powered by PunBB
Textpattern.ru